The VMIVME-7750 is a high-performance 6U VMEbus single board computer (SBC) developed by Abaco Systems (formerly GE Fanuc).
Powered by the Intel Pentium III processor architecture, this SBC provides deterministic real-time computing for legacy embedded control systems. It is widely used as a processing core in aerospace, defense, and industrial automation platforms, including modernization projects for turbine control systems.
The board integrates dual Ethernet ports, VGA graphics output, and serial communication interfaces, reducing the need for external expansion hardware. ECC memory support and industrial-grade thermal design improve reliability in vibration-prone and temperature-variable environments.
| Parameter | Specification |
|---|---|
| Model | VMIVME-7750 |
| Processor | Intel Pentium III (733–933 MHz typical) |
| L2 Cache | 256 KB / 512 KB |
| Memory | Up to 512 MB SDRAM (ECC protected) |
| Storage | CompactFlash Type II + IDE support |
| Network | Dual 10/100 Mbps Ethernet |
| Graphics | AGP SVGA (up to 1600 × 1200) |
| OS Support | Windows NT/2000, Linux, VxWorks, QNX |
| Operating Temperature | 0°C to +55°C (standard) |

Q1: Does it support modern operating systems?
Yes. It supports legacy Windows NT/2000/XP, Linux distributions, and RTOS environments such as VxWorks and QNX, with proper VMEbus driver support.
Q2: Can the RAM be upgraded?
Yes, but memory must meet manufacturer timing and voltage specifications to ensure system stability. Memory is typically installed via ECC-enabled SODIMM modules.
